# Break-Glass: Catalog Cache Invalidation

Scope: the Pinrow product catalog at Veldstone Retail. If stale prices persist after a purge and the Hollowmere invalidation queue is wedged, use break-glass to flush the edge tier directly. Contractors: get verbal sign-off from the catalog lead first. Steps: open the Hollowmere admin shell, select emergency-flush, confirm the tenant, and run it once — repeated flushes thrash the origin. Access is logged and expires after 20 minutes. Unseal the admin shell with the passphrase below.

recovery phrase for kahop-tajog: istix-casvan

/*
 * Parity constants for the Lanternwood Swift and Kotlin SDKs.
 * Both clients MUST read retry, timeout, and cache-TTL values
 * from this module; do not hardcode them per platform. Any
 * drift here shows up as divergent sync behavior and pages
 * whoever is on call. If you change a value, bump PARITY_REV
 * and cut both SDK releases in the same window. Current
 * shared tuning constants are as follows.
 */

tuning table, yajog-yahof:
BUDGETS = {
    "lamvan": 303,
    "wenox": 460,
    "fenvan": 525,
}

### Pool Car Key Cabinet — Night Shift

The key cabinet for the Ashgrove pool cars is mounted in the loading bay corridor, next to the fire panel. Night shift staff taking a vehicle must log the registration and departure time in the binder on the shelf, and hang the key back on its numbered hook on return. Report any missing keys to the duty coordinator before end of shift. The cabinet keypad code is shown below.

staff pass of kawip-hawef = bdg-QLP-2